*Job Description \& Summary**
We are seeking a highly analytical and technically robust **Senior Performance Engineer** to ensure our enterprise applications meet the highest standards of scalability, reliability, and speed.
In this role, you will not just execute tests; you will own the end\-to\-end performance engineering lifecycle. You will simulate complex, high\-concurrency user traffic, analyze systemic bottlenecks across distributed architectures, and partner with development teams to optimize code, database queries, and infrastructure configuration.
The ideal candidate possesses deep expertise in modern load\-testing tools and a masterful command of industry\-leading APM and observability platforms.
*\*Responsibilities:**
*Performance Testing \& Simulation**
**Test Strategy \& Modeling:** Define comprehensive performance test plans, workload models, and non\-functional requirements, NFRs, based on production business metrics.
**Scripting \& Execution:** Design, maintain, and execute highly scalable load, stress, endurance, spike, and scalability tests using a variety of protocols and tools, k6, JMeter, NeoLoad , or LoadRunner.
**CI/CD Integration:** Integrate automated performance regression testing shifts left into deployment pipelines, using Jenkins, GitLab CI, or GitHub Actions, to catch performance regressions early in the SDLC.
*Deep\-Dive Diagnostics \& Observability**
**Full\-Stack Bottleneck Analysis:** Utilize APM tools, Dynatrace, AppDynamics, Datadog, to isolate performance bottlenecks across application layers, microservices, JVMs/NET runtimes, and databases.
**Log Analysis \& Pattern Matching:** Build advanced queries, dashboards, and alerts in Splunk or Datadog to analyze error rates, latency distribution, and anomalous system behavior during load events.
**Code \& Architecture Optimization:** Analyze thread dumps, heap dumps, CPU profiles, network latency, and database execution plans to provide actionable optimization recommendations to software engineers.
*Reporting** **\& Stakeholder Management**
**Data\-Driven Reporting:** Translate raw performance test data into executive\-friendly summaries and highly detailed technical reports.
**Capacity Planning:** Analyze production growth trends and performance test results to forecast future infrastructure capacity needs.
